Homeschooling in Bali comes with its own set of unique challenges and rewards, especially as we step into 2025. One of the big focuses for our family this year is striking the right balance between digital learning and handwriting practice. After all, while our kids’ typing skills have soared from the paper-free approach we tried in 2024, there’s something timeless and incredibly valuable about putting pencil to paper. ✍️✨ When we returned to Australia late last year, I made it a mission to stock up on all the resource books we’d need. From workbooks that encourage creative writing to simple practice sheets for letter formation—these tools are now key players in our day-to-day learning routine here in Bali. The tactile process of writing has not only been beneficial for their fine motor skills but has also added a grounding element to our otherwise screen-heavy curriculum. Of course, homeschooling in Bali offers unique opportunities to embrace flexibility. Resources aren’t always as accessible here, and that’s a challenge many traveling families experience. Yet, with the stunning natural environment 🌴🌏 and a thriving world schooling community, adaptation becomes second nature. For us, this has meant finding harmony between leveraging technology for subjects like coding and math while incorporating just enough traditional handwriting to ensure we’re keeping things well-rounded. The bonus? These shifts also give us quality downtime away from devices to bond over shared creative moments as a family. Whether it’s journaling about a beach day or drawing diagrams for science lessons, a pencil and a blank sheet of paper have become tools for connection as much as learning. If you’re considering homeschooling in Bali, my advice is to keep it balanced—embrace the digital, but don’t forget the power of old-school handwriting.
